What Is a Dental Crown?
A dental crown, sometimes called a dental cap, is a customized restoration that covers a damaged or weakened tooth. It can help restore the tooth’s shape, strength, function and appearance.
According to Cleveland Clinic, dental crowns may be recommended for teeth that are weak, cracked, worn, broken or severely decayed. They may also be used to cover a tooth after root canal treatment or to restore a dental implant.
However, not every damaged tooth automatically needs a crown. Your dentist should first examine the tooth and determine whether a filling, inlay, onlay, root canal treatment, crown or another treatment is more appropriate.

2. Understand the Different Types of Dental Crowns
One of the biggest decisions is choosing the crown material.
Zirconia Crowns
Zirconia is a popular option when patients want a combination of strength and aesthetics.
It can be particularly useful when durability is an important consideration. However, whether zirconia is appropriate for your tooth depends on your individual clinical situation.
Porcelain or Ceramic Crowns
Porcelain and ceramic restorations are popular when natural-looking aesthetics are a major priority.

PFM Crowns
Porcelain-fused-to-metal crowns combine a metal substructure with a tooth-coloured outer layer. They can offer a balance between strength and appearance, although your dentist should determine whether this material is appropriate for the specific tooth.
Metal Crowns
Metal crowns can offer excellent durability and may be considered for certain posterior teeth. However, their metallic appearance may make them less desirable when aesthetics are a primary concern.
E-Max and Other Ceramic Options
Modern ceramic systems can provide highly aesthetic restorations, particularly where appearance is important. The ADA notes that contemporary ceramic materials have evolved significantly, with different materials offering different combinations of strength, aesthetics and clinical indications.
Important: Don’t choose a crown material based only on an online comparison. Your dentist should recommend the material after assessing the tooth and your bite.
3. Consider the Location of Your Tooth
The location of the tooth makes a difference.
Front Teeth
For front teeth, appearance and colour matching are often major considerations. A natural-looking ceramic or porcelain restoration may be appropriate depending on your case.
Back Teeth
Molars experience substantial chewing forces. Strength and resistance to fracture may therefore become particularly important.
This is why the same crown material may not be ideal for every tooth.
A good dentist should explain why a particular crown is being recommended for your specific tooth, rather than simply offering one material to every patient.
4. Check Whether You Need Root Canal Treatment First
If the tooth has deep decay, infection or significant pulp damage, placing a crown without treating the underlying problem may not solve the issue.
Root canal treatment is designed to remove infected or inflamed pulp, disinfect the root canal system and seal it. The tooth can subsequently be restored with a filling or crown depending on its remaining structure and clinical needs.

8. Ask About the Expected Lifespan
Dental crowns are durable, but they are not permanent or indestructible.
Cleveland Clinic states that crowns can last approximately 5 to 15 years with proper care, although actual longevity varies according to factors such as oral hygiene, tooth location, biting forces, crown material and individual circumstances.
To help your crown last longer:
- Brush twice a day
- Clean between your teeth regularly
- Attend routine dental check-ups
- Avoid using your teeth to open packages
- Follow your dentist’s recommendations
- Address teeth grinding if applicable
- Contact your dentist if the crown becomes loose, chipped or uncomfortable

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Which dental crown is best in Noida Sector 79?
There is no universally best crown for every patient. Zirconia, porcelain, ceramic, PFM and metal crowns have different properties. Your dentist should select the appropriate material according to the tooth’s location, remaining structure, bite, aesthetics and overall oral health.
2. Is a dental crown necessary after root canal treatment?
A crown may be recommended after root canal treatment when the remaining tooth structure requires additional protection. The exact restoration depends on the tooth and the amount of healthy structure remaining. The American Association of Endodontists notes that root-canal-treated teeth are subsequently restored with a crown or filling depending on the case.
3. How long does a dental crown last?
With proper care, dental crowns can last for many years. Cleveland Clinic gives an approximate range of 5–15 years, although individual results vary.
4. Is dental crown treatment painful?
The level of discomfort depends on the condition of the tooth and the procedure required. Local anesthesia is commonly used during tooth preparation. If you have significant pain before treatment, your dentist should first determine the underlying cause.
5. Can a crown look like a natural tooth?
Yes. Tooth-coloured ceramic and porcelain restorations can be customized to match surrounding teeth. The Dental Crowns’ porcelain crown service specifically describes customization around colour, shape and size.
6. How much does a dental crown cost in Noida Sector 79?
The cost varies depending on the material, tooth condition, laboratory work, additional procedures and complexity of the case. Instead of relying on a generic online price, ask the dental clinic for a case-specific quotation after examination.
7. Can I get a crown without a root canal?
Yes, if the tooth does not require root canal treatment. A crown is not automatically associated with an RCT. Your dentist should assess the tooth’s pulp and structural condition before recommending treatment.
